Construct a reliable environment for measuring Hyperlight performance #707

Because we are currently running Hyperlight with nested virtualization on public clouds, there is a lot of noise in micro-benchmarks, and it is not clear that they are at all useful (e.g. time of day seems to influence some quite a lot). We should find a more reliable environment for running benchmarks, ideally including a dedicated hardware host without NV overhead, isolated cores, frequency pinning, etc. We should separately also still run benchmarks in an NV partition in order to better reflect our expected use cases, but try our best to make this reproducible as well.
